Web17 Nov 2024 · What Size Sonotubes Should I Use for 4x4s, 6x6s, and Deck Footings? As a rule of thumb, you should always use a Sonotube with a diameter that is three times your desired post’s width. So, if you were planning to install a 4×4 post, a 12-inch Sonotube would be appropriate. Meanwhile, a 6×6 post would warrant an 18” Sonotube. WebA concrete deck block can support quite a bit of weight as it normally has a footprint of 12 x 12 inches. This is 144 square inches. A typical deck pier footing that might be specified by an architect or engineer might be 20 or 24 inches in diameter.
